8 imperial
1. [ımʹpı(ə)rıəl] n1. эспаньолка ( бородка)2. ист.1) империал, второй этаж с сиденьями для пассажиров (в дилижансах, омнибусах и т. п.)2) верх кареты для поклажи3. предмет высшего качества или большого размера ( в торговле)4. ист. империал, старинная русская золотая монета5. формат бумаги (23 Ҳ31 д.)2. [ımʹpı(ə)rıəl] a1. 1) имперский, относящийся к империиimperial flag [coat of arms] - имперский флаг [герб]
imperial city - столица империи (особ. о Риме)
2) ( часто Imperial) ист. относящийся к Британской империи, имперскийimperial preferences - эк. имперские преференции
2. императорскийimperial crown [sceptre, throne] - императорская корона [-ий скипетр, трон]
3. суверенный; верховный4. величественный, царственный, великолепный5. высшего качества или большого размераimperial drink - разг. великолепный напиток, нектар
6. установленный, стандартный ( об английских мерах)imperial weights and measures - единицы веса и измерения, принятые в Великобритании
